which dermatome(s) is(are) typically completely unaffected by carpal tunnel syndrome? (maca) c5 c6 c7 c8

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Carpal Tunnel Syndrome (CTS) affects the median nerve, which innervates dermatomes from C6 to C8 (with C6/C7 being more prominently involved in hand regions affected by CTS). The C5 dermatome supplies the upper arm and shoulder area, which is not innervated by the median nerve and thus is completely unaffected by CTS.

Answer:

C5
